This "grand floral" is a classic for a reason, but be warned: it's not for the faint of heart. Expect a heady, old-school bouquet that demands to be noticed, with some finding it intoxicating and others, frankly, overwhelming.
This Brazilian classic is a true crowd-pleaser for those who love a clean, fresh lavender. However, its staying power is a bone of contention - many rave about its nostalgic charm but lament its fleeting presence. Perfect for a quick, calming spritz, but don't expect it to last all day.

Occasions
Its potent projection and long-lasting nature make it too much for most office settings, but perfect for formal events or a romantic date night. The rich, heady florals lend themselves poorly to casual or sporty activities.

Occasions
Its fresh accords and generally weak performance make Thaty perfect for casual, close-quarters wear or after a shower. It's too subtle for formal events or impactful dates, but its lightness means it won't offend in an office setting and can be refreshing for sport.
